Discover top Iqaluit attractions
Iqaluit, the capital of Nunavut, offers a unique blend of Arctic adventure and cultural immersion, perfect for the Quality Seeker. Begin your exploration at the Nunatta Sunakkutaangit Museum, where you can delve into the rich history and heritage of the Inuit culture through fascinating artefacts and local art. For those seeking an adrenaline rush, the breathtaking landscapes surrounding Iqaluit provide ample opportunities for hiking and wildlife spotting—keep your eyes peeled for migrating beluga whales in the summer months. The stunning views of Frobisher Bay from the Apex Trail are particularly rewarding, especially during sunset. Adventurous families can participate in a guided dog sledding tour, which not only provides an exhilarating ride but also an insight into the traditional Inuit way of life. Finally, a visit to the local markets where you can sample fresh Arctic char and traditional bannock is a must for food enthusiasts.
